WebProlotherapy is the injection of an irritant solution (usually a form of sugar called dextrose) into joints, ligaments or tendons. It usually involves three to four or more shots given monthly for several months, followed by occasional, as-needed injections.

WebJan 12, 2024 · Prolotherapy, or dextrose prolotherapy: This treatment is also known as a form of ‘regenerative medicine’, has been used over the last 70 years and has been shown to be safe. It comprises injections of dextrose with or without a dilute phenol solution. This acts as an osmotic and chemical irritant. This solution is injected around ligaments ... WebFeb 21, 2011 · Prolotherapy Versus PRP The use of hyperosmolar dextrose (prolotherapy) has been shown to increase platelet-derived growth factor expression and up-regulate multiple mitogenic factors72 that may act as signaling mechanisms in tendon repair.
